Transaction 34d1d04b2afb6f5f15b61815bdc4ea9ed81c3113a0a72b2dfa6efeb338fc7ef8

1 Input
1 Outputs
  • 34d1d04b2afb6f5f15b61815bdc4ea9ed81c3113a0a72b2dfa6efeb338fc7ef8:0
  • value  501608
    address  3BFMr1M7XASU2usXQxJ6npjFYmRa7wXauF